The Director, Client Services, 3PL will be responsible for driving the complete, end-to-end client program operational experience for the 3PL business. The Director is responsible for business growth with existing manufacturers while ensuring the overall integrity of the 3PL program product offerings. The Director will assist in the oversight of the Client Services department including training, setting goals, and executing the company’s strategic plan to achieve top and bottom-line revenue objectives. The Director is a people manager role, and they will assist in the growth and development of direct report contributors as well as aid all other Client Services contributors. They will partner with service line leaders across the organization to achieve synergies and drive growth.

Based out of Louisville, Kentucky location only.

Responsibilities

  • Enable growth. Responsible for maintaining and strengthening the 3PL Client Services, including supporting Strategic Account Managers with quarterly business reviews, scoping client requirements, assessing them against Knipper capabilities and building the program, collaboratively with the client. Bring ideas that will increase the company’s competitiveness and allow us to be positioned as the innovative industry leader as a custom solution partner for pharmaceutical brand drug manufacturers.
  • Work collaboratively. Lead the Account Management function within the 3PL business. Connect with others within the 3PL business such as customer service, warehouse operations, and commercial development to remain aligned with program needs and growth expectations. Leverage these internal relationships to create and customize new 3PL services clients. Work across with the other parts of Knipper (pharmacy, sampling, etc.) to benchmark departmental performance relative to peer functions.
  • Build teams and develop people. Creates a positive culture that is dedicated to providing, exceptional customer experiences while being fair, inclusive, and encouraging to associates. Recruit, train, grow, and develop associates so that they have the necessary skills to be successful and expand their careers within Knipper. Drive associate commitment and engagement. Assists in the training and development of Senior-level Account Executives to review client goals and program health.
  • Achieves departmental goals along with the reporting needed to provide meaningful/quantifiable feedback to the level of goal accomplishment.
  • Works closely with management and internal department staff to create, establish and record well-defined business rules for various program models to help facilitate ongoing quality assurance and review processes and procedures for continual improvement and efficiency.
  • Expand client relationships. Creates and develops deep relationships with clients based on satisfaction with the knowledge conveyed by client analytics and report experience. Is able to take new clients, create a unique offering for them, and to build upon that relationship to ensure maximum satisfaction. Grows trust and confidence in the client relationship to ensure that Knipper is the first commercialization partner they consider for 3PL.

Qualifications

REQUIRED E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E:

  • Bachelor’s degree
  • 5 years of progressive Client Services (3PL) experience, preferably within the pharmaceutical, biotech, or medical device industry.
  • One (1) year of people management experience
  • A strategic and agile thinker with the entrepreneurial skills to grow the Account Management function within the 3PL business.
  • Excellent communicator, who genuinely respects every level of associate and each person’s ability to contribute to the company’s performance and can collaborate across the organization.

PREFERRED E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E:

  • Master’s Degree

K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S & ABILITIES:

  • Excellent communication skills including but not limited to documentation, presentation, and training meeting facilitation
  • Excellent interpersonal skills – an excellent communicator, who genuinely respects every level of associate and each person’s ability to contribute to the company’s performance
  • Excellent organization skills and detail oriented
  • Excellent analytical and problem-solving skills
  • Excellent technical skills to include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and Outlook)
  • Ability to competitively differentiate and increase share by delivering market solutions that demonstrate quantifiable value to clients and prospects
  • Ability to execute projects within scope, schedule, and budget
  • Ability to balance multiple priorities to meet expected response deadlines
  • Ability to establish and maintain effective working relationships with key stakeholders
  • Ability to think with a strategic and agile mindset
  • Demonstrate leadership skills in successfully managing teams and collaborating
  • Demonstrate ability to influence, direct and guide a team
  • Demonstrate knowledge of process improvement techniques
  • Demonstrate proven experience growing a logistics provider
  • Demonstrate entrepreneurial skills to manage the complexity of a multi-client environment, a diverse service basket, multiple market segments (biotech/pharma/med device), competing client priorities, and aggressive growth
